Yes. Lab diamonds are graded using the same 4Cs system as mined diamonds: cut, color, clarity, and carat weight. Certifications from labs like IGI, GIA, and GCAL are available. Reputable retailers provide certification documentation with every lab diamond so you know exactly what you are getting.
The most effective home cleaning method is mild dish soap mixed with warm water and a soft-bristled toothbrush. Gently scrub the stone and setting, rinse thoroughly, and pat dry with a lint-free cloth. Avoid harsh chemicals like bleach or chlorine, and remove the ring before activities that expose it to abrasive materials or hard impacts. Yes. The marquise cut has the largest face-up surface area of any shape at a given carat weight. A 2 carat marquise can appear closer to 2.5 carats when viewed from above, and its elongated silhouette also creates a slimming, lengthening effect on the finger. This makes it one of the most visually impactful options at 2 carats.
Yes, marquise cuts are prone to the bow-tie effect, a dark shadow across the center of the stone where light is not returned efficiently. A faint bow-tie is common and acceptable. A strong, dark bow-tie is undesirable. Cut quality and proportions determine how pronounced the bow-tie is, making it important to evaluate the specific stone rather than just relying on specs.
